Output 22f7f5e71374f2bcc0a1fc0a2974c545b243178da7537f3e48a9c30d6707660b:3

value
17780306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de11dc4514acd20f208096b90176dff9c9d065d3 OP_EQUAL
address
3MwDL6S4z7GyLv6WRmSDbDaM1EwZCoetEk
transaction
22f7f5e71374f2bcc0a1fc0a2974c545b243178da7537f3e48a9c30d6707660b
confirmations
373145
spent
true